(Z)-1-bromo-3-iodobut-2-ene
TL;DR: (Z)-1-bromo-3-iodobut-2-ene (CAS 500771-20-0) is a chemical compound with molecular formula C4H6BrI and molecular weight 259.87 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
(Z)-1-bromo-3-iodobut-2-ene
Also Known As: ghl.PD_Mitscher_leg0.446, 1-bromo-3-iodobut-2-ene, 4-bromo-2-iodobut-2-ene, 2-Iodo-4-bromo-2-butene, 4-Bromo-2-iodo-2-butene
| Molecular Formula | C4H6BrI |
|---|---|
| Molecular Weight | 259.87 g/mol |
| LogP | 2.7201 |
| Topological Polar Surface Area | 0.0 Ų |
| Hydrogen Bond Donors | 0 |
| Hydrogen Bond Acceptors | 0 |
| Rotatable Bonds | 1 |
| Exact Mass | 259.86975 |
| Heavy Atoms | 6 |
| Complexity | 54.568424 |
Chemical Identifiers
| CAS Number | 500771-20-0 |
|---|---|
| SMILES | C/C(=C/CBr)/I |
